Question 423740: Tina is training for a biathlon. To train for the running portion of the race, she runs 10 miles each day, over the same course. The first 4 miles of the course is on level ground, while the last 6 miles is downhill. She runs 4 miles per hour slower on level ground than she runs downhill. If the complete course takes 1 hour, how fast does she run on the downhill part of the course

Question 427553: Please help me set up this problem:
"A canoe can travel 15 mph in still water. Going with the current it can travel 20 miles in the same time that it takes to travel 10 miles against the current. Find the rate of the current."

Question 427561: Please help me set up this problem:
"The excursion boat Holiday travels 35 km upstream and then back again in 4 hours and 48 minutes. If the speed of the Holiday in still water is 15 km/ hour, what is the speed of the current?"

Question 427559: Please help me set up this problem:
"When Ace Airlines changed to planes that flew 100km/hour faster than its old ones, the time of its 2800 km Dallas-Seattle flight was reduced by 30 minutes. Find the speed of the new planes."
